Step-Up to Emergency Medicine

Step-Up to Emergency Medicine

Pages: 496,
Specialty: Emergency Med,
Publisher: Wolters Kluwer,
Publication Year: 2016,
Cover: Paperback,
Dimensions: 213x277x18mm

An important addition to the popular Step-Up series, Step-Up to Emergency Medicine uses the proven series format to provide a high-yield review of emergency medicine, ideal for preparing for clerkships/clinical rotations, end of rotation/shelf exams, and the USMLE Step 2. Clinical pearls, full-color illustrations, and "Quick Hits" provide essential information in an efficient, easy-to-remember manner, perfect for medical, physician assistant, and nurse practitioner students.
